F-84 Thunderjet vs Su-27 Flanker
Overview
The F-84 Thunderjet and the Su-27 Flanker are both Combat Aircraft, manufactured by Republic and Sukhoi respectively.
The Su-27 Flanker reaches 2,500 km/h β 2.5x the F-84 Thunderjet's 1,001 km/h. The F-84 Thunderjet has an operational range of 1,080 km vs 3,530 km for the Su-27 Flanker. The Su-27 Flanker operates at altitudes up to 18,500 m compared to 12,344 m for the F-84 Thunderjet. At 30,000 kg MTOW, the Su-27 Flanker is 2.8x the F-84 Thunderjet's 10,590 kg.
The F-84 Thunderjet has been produced in 7,524 units vs 680 for the Su-27 Flanker. Unit cost is $1.4M for the F-84 Thunderjet vs $30M for the Su-27 Flanker. The F-84 Thunderjet first flew 32 years before the Su-27 Flanker (1946 vs 1978).
